Hyperbaric Oxygen Therapy (HBOT)
Hyperbaric oxygen therapy is a highly effective treatment that supports healing by increasing oxygen delivery to tissues. During the treatment, patients breathe pure oxygen in a pressurized environment, allowing oxygen to dissolve more efficiently into the bloodstream and reach areas with reduced circulation.
This increased oxygen availability plays a critical role in wound healing, reducing inflammation, and supporting tissue regeneration. It is particularly beneficial after surgical procedures, including facial lifting surgeries, where optimal healing is essential.
By enhancing cellular activity and improving circulation, hyperbaric oxygen therapy contributes to faster recovery and improved tissue quality. It is often recommended as part of a comprehensive post-operative care plan to support optimal healing outcomes.
